Evolution is always happening — so why can't we see it? A biologist explains the timescale problem, election pressure, and ...
Android versions: A living history from 1.0 to 17 Explore Android's ongoing evolution with this visual timeline of versions, starting B.C. (Before Cupcake) and going all the way to 2026's Android 17 ...